The origin of the first name "Augst" is unclear. It does not appear to be a widely recognized or commonly used name. It is possible that "Augst" could be a variant or variation of other names such as August or Augusta, which have different origins. August is a male name of Latin origin, derived from the Latin word "augustus," meaning "great" or "venerable." It was historically used as a title for Roman emperors and has been used as a given name since the 18th century. Augusta is a female name also of Latin origin, derived from the same Latin word. It is the feminine form of August and has been used as a given name since the 18th century as well. Famous people with the name Augst

August is not a commonly found first name among famous individuals, but there are a few notable figures who have borne it. One such person is Auguste Rodin, a renowned French sculptor who is considered one of the fathers of modern sculpture. His iconic works like "The Thinker" and "The Kiss" have left an indelible mark on the art world. Another famous August is August Strindberg, a Swedish playwright, novelist, and poet. Strindberg's works, including plays like "Miss Julie" and "The Ghost Sonata," are highly regarded for their exploration of human psychology and societal norms. Additionally, August Derleth deserves mention for his contributions to literature and as the co-creator of the Cthulhu Mythos, a fictional universe originated by H.P. Lovecraft.
